ADRF6720-27 RFoutput problem。

MY ADRF6720-27's REFIN is 80M。I want to set 1700MHZ RF frequency。

Here is my config register set:

reg 00 == h0000};
reg 01 == hF6FF};
reg 10 == hF6FF};
reg 20 == h0C26};
reg 21 == h000B};
reg 22 == h2A03};
reg 30 == h0000};
reg 31 == h1101};
reg 32 == h0900};
reg 33 == h0000};
reg 40 == h0010};
reg 42 == h000E};
reg 43 == h0000};
reg 45 == h0000};
reg 49 == h16BD};
reg 02 == h0855};
reg 03 == h0000};
reg 04 == h0000}; 

The PLL of my ADRF6720-27 is locked,and the LOOUT can output 1700MHZ when i set reg22 = 0x2a23.

But the RFOUT of my ADRF6720-27 is not corret,here is my wave。

What is the problem?

  • Hello Oh,

    How does the baseband inputs of ADRF6720-27 interface to? If it is DAC like AD9152/AD9154, ADRF6720-27 can interface to AD9152/54 directly in DC coupling like Figure 45 in ADRF6720-27 datasheet. If you are in AC coupling application, you need a level shifter. Below is an example to meet 2.7V common-mode voltage requirement on baseband inputs of ADRF6720-27. If you are using a DAC on 0.5V output common mode voltage like AD9122/9144, you can interface it to ADRF6720 directly without a level shifter. You can refer to Figure 45 in ADRF6720 datasheet at this case.
